Dog put down after Coleraine attack

Police have appealed for information after a dog belonging to a Coleraine pensioner had to be put down after an attack.

The Jack Russell dog called ‘Busker’, was attacked in the Maple Drive area between the hours of 6am and 10am on Sunday.

Unfortunately Busker failed to recover from his injuries and has since been put down by the Vet.

The injuries are believed to have been caused by a blunt object, possibly a hammer.

Police are appealing for anyone who may have information in relation to this offence.

If you can assist the investigation in any way, please call the non-emergency number 101.
